Default JDM B16B into a 2000 DX Sedan. Wiring Confusion

Hello all. I am putting a B16B into 2000 Civic DX and it seems that the shock tower harness is different and I may have to re-pin? Also, where the ECU plugs in there is one extra gray connector with I am unsure of where it goes. Photos to follow.

I need this car running ASAP, so any help will be greatly appreciated!

Default Re: JDM B16B into a 2000 DX Sedan. Wiring Confusion

0the b16b ecu is more than likely obd2a , your car is obd2b . Can you snap a picture of the ecu you are using, and all your ecu plugs.

you might need a step down harness or swap to obd1 ecu ( with a chipe or tune ) .

shock tower harness , dont think you need to swap this out.

are you trying to use the b16b harness

Default Re: JDM B16B into a 2000 DX Sedan. Wiring Confusion

how does the back of your ecu look:

being a 2000 DX ( these came with the d16y7 in US correct ) . you will have the bottom picture ( obd2b ) , and most 99 00 jdm ecus are obd2a ( atleast was like this with my itr p73 and PCT ecu that were from 99 and 00 motors )
